From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 02357CED614 for ; Wed, 9 Oct 2024 07:27:58 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:Content-Type: Content-Transfer-Encoding: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:Message-ID:References:In-Reply-To:Subject:Cc:To:From :Date:MIME-Version:Reply-To: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=AR4YbgxSsxt10aIJWAVDnN4QV6uxel/Zotxb46SGj/U=; b=h/I06wL+SveQN2FPKHF5sQ5ytx bGoDMP0KBqCHIdVRpd1tXP5BZPA5Fg66I1yZO3CR/nQGfVcG0vLaEcIT3tAT6b9ieAUHaoOu69p4B 8qkPpRti7Zx59pdn0PKFexCk9VjFj4HC6xNz6Y1Uo4UEvnk2YpSPwuwgP3w3/j04CsXZLZpsimBqS +r104HOq+3NuTUg0+lAvh7Qq223CahGbaiigDdz2bz4IN6p4UUzx6tzoJjGnp6QyU9n7NVjAEXJPd hs8eVDPZ0dIcK0BmENdegD8Me9qvB9GXP0MGhTxWXTQjBIzWqsWbsA7O3VzF1JK6xJxepc7j/w4v7 nMC9qU4Q==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98 #2 (Red Hat Linux)) id 1syR6x-00000008EEZ-1xR7; Wed, 09 Oct 2024 07:27:55 +0000 Received: from mail.manjaro.org ([116.203.91.91]) by bombadil.infradead.org with esmtps (Exim 4.98 #2 (Red Hat Linux)) id 1syR5c-00000008E2k-1NxM; Wed, 09 Oct 2024 07:26:33 +0000 MIME-Version: 1.0 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=manjaro.org; s=2021; t=1728458790;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=g8NBbsg2U9zV9iA6cedWwT4mdfKXU/bO9gUUqrFHKwY=; b=pM6Vk7nIhBNLKE5YXjc2goR2zfXNKwIDhEYuevFlhZI94mXb4gvR+8DiqOgVbe6lJOccAc c2eXzcDVuiFqMuT0vK9UzqcIl3UFSQqFkRSOxe4O0fffzzg/G4XMsBrOvmI2KnbSIVrIce ys4eMWtaWE6DHNPF6cThzw+KNUE3qto1BIOIcB0F3TDGHst9Wb40e5mRN1DalsM5QJN/tH Tfz6O+dUwitIycmBtTbHC4QVQrdTcNjdnPWEGdTGCJPCOuuG+a9ztJpGQS7PzjABgUG9Gz V21Qy0Jkr9I6EbVQe7r7dfBr2ryjm2cMk7gSVriSWr6M7NsrMQ0KkLEGKpCTnA== Date: Wed, 09 Oct 2024 09:26:30 +0200 From: Dragan Simic To: Heiko Stuebner Cc: linux-rockchip@lists.infradead.org, linux-arm-kernel@lists.infradead.org, devicetree@vger.kernel.org, Michael Riesch , Muhammed Efe Cetin Subject: Re: [PATCH v2 09/14] arm64: dts: rockchip: Remove 'enable-active-low' from two boards In-Reply-To: <20241008203940.2573684-10-heiko@sntech.de> References: <20241008203940.2573684-1-heiko@sntech.de> <20241008203940.2573684-10-heiko@sntech.de> Message-ID: <0621088b23e24ddec4076267bdfa1a39@manjaro.org> X-Sender: dsimic@manjaro.org Authentication-Results: ORIGINATING; auth=pass smtp.auth=dsimic@manjaro.org smtp.mailfrom=dsimic@manjaro.org X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20241009_002632_689296_0342B79A X-CRM114-Status: GOOD ( 14.71 ) X-BeenThere: linux-rockchip@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Upstream kernel work for Rockchip platforms List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Transfer-Encoding: 7bit Content-Type: text/plain; charset="us-ascii"; Format="flowed" Sender: "Linux-rockchip" Errors-To: linux-rockchip-bounces+linux-rockchip=archiver.kernel.org@lists.infradead.org Hello Heiko, On 2024-10-08 22:39, Heiko Stuebner wrote: > The 'enable-active-low' property is not a valid, because it is the s/is not a valid/is not valid/ > default behaviour of the fixed regulator. > > Only 'enable-active-high' is valid, and when this property is absent > the fixed regulator will act as active low by default. > > Both the rk3588-orange-pi-5 and the Wolfvision pf5 io expander overlay > smuggled those enable-active-low properties in, so remove them to > make dtbscheck happier. > > Fixes: 28799a7734a0 ("arm64: dts: rockchip: add wolfvision pf5 io > expander board") > Cc: Michael Riesch > Fixes: b6bc755d806e ("arm64: dts: rockchip: Add Orange Pi 5") > Cc: Muhammed Efe Cetin > > Signed-off-by: Heiko Stuebner Looking good to me, thanks for the patch. According to the bindings in Documentation/devicetree/bindings/regulator/fixed-regulator.yaml, only "enable-active-high" is supported. Reviewed-by: Dragan Simic > --- > .../boot/dts/rockchip/rk3568-wolfvision-pf5-io-expander.dtso | 1 - > arch/arm64/boot/dts/rockchip/rk3588s-orangepi-5.dts | 1 - > 2 files changed, 2 deletions(-) > > diff --git > a/arch/arm64/boot/dts/rockchip/rk3568-wolfvision-pf5-io-expander.dtso > b/arch/arm64/boot/dts/rockchip/rk3568-wolfvision-pf5-io-expander.dtso > index ebcaeafc3800..fa61633aea15 100644 > --- > a/arch/arm64/boot/dts/rockchip/rk3568-wolfvision-pf5-io-expander.dtso > +++ > b/arch/arm64/boot/dts/rockchip/rk3568-wolfvision-pf5-io-expander.dtso > @@ -49,7 +49,6 @@ vcc1v8_eth: vcc1v8-eth-regulator { > > vcc3v3_eth: vcc3v3-eth-regulator { > compatible = "regulator-fixed"; > - enable-active-low; > gpio = <&gpio0 RK_PC0 GPIO_ACTIVE_LOW>; > pinctrl-names = "default"; > pinctrl-0 = <&vcc3v3_eth_enn>; > diff --git a/arch/arm64/boot/dts/rockchip/rk3588s-orangepi-5.dts > b/arch/arm64/boot/dts/rockchip/rk3588s-orangepi-5.dts > index feea6b20a6bf..6b77be643249 100644 > --- a/arch/arm64/boot/dts/rockchip/rk3588s-orangepi-5.dts > +++ b/arch/arm64/boot/dts/rockchip/rk3588s-orangepi-5.dts > @@ -71,7 +71,6 @@ vcc5v0_sys: vcc5v0-sys-regulator { > > vcc_3v3_sd_s0: vcc-3v3-sd-s0-regulator { > compatible = "regulator-fixed"; > - enable-active-low; > gpios = <&gpio4 RK_PB5 GPIO_ACTIVE_LOW>; > regulator-name = "vcc_3v3_sd_s0"; > regulator-boot-on; _______________________________________________ Linux-rockchip mailing list Linux-rockchip@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-rockchip